Meaning
means(noun) the act of giving hope or support to someone
boost, encouragement
means(noun) an increase in cost; "they asked for a 10% rise in rates"
boost, cost increase, rise, hike
means(noun) the act of giving a push; "he gave her a boost over the fence"
boost
means(verb) increase; "The landlord hiked up the rents"
boost, hike, hike up
means(verb) give a boost to; be beneficial to; "The tax cut will boost the economy"
boost
means(verb) contribute to the progress or growth of; "I am promoting the use of computers in the classroom"
advance, boost, encourage, further, promote
means(verb) increase or raise; "boost the voltage in an electrical circuit"
supercharge, advance, boost
means(verb) push or shove upward, as if from below or behind; "The singer had to be boosted onto the stage by a special contraption"
boost
